After a disagreement with his parents over a big streaming deal, Wyatt is left uncertain about the future. When things cool down, he's excited to hear they've come around but with one condition-their lawyer must approve the contract first.
Once the contract gets the green light, Wyatt is on top of the world, ready to live out his dreams. But later that day, he stumbles across news that makes him question everything about his new team.
Can Wyatt hold on to his friendships with the Stream Team members even though he's no longer gaming with them? And will they ever forgive him for leaving them to chase his dream?
Find out in Totally Tilted, a story about chasing dreams, navigating friendships, and discovering what really matters.
Kevin Miller grew up on a farm outside of Foam Lake, Saskatchewan, where he dreamed of becoming a writer. He got his first break as a newspaper reporter in Meadow Lake, SK. Within a year, he parlayed that into a job in book publishing, which eventually enabled him to become a full-time freelance writer and editor. From there, Kevin transitioned into film, and he spent the next thirteen years traveling the world while working on a variety of feature films, documentaries, and short film projects. In addition to serving as a writer, he has also worked as a director, producer, and film editor.
These days, Kevin splits his time between filmmaking, writing, editing, and teaching. When he's not working, he enjoys hanging out with his wife and four kids, fishing, hiking, canoeing, skiing, skateboarding, and otherwise
exploring his world.
